Tsunan Sake Brewery Co., Ltd. (Head Office: Tsunan Town, Nakauonuma District, Niigata Prefecture; President and CEO: Kengo Suzuki, hereinafter “Tsunan Brewery”) is pleased to announce that on Saturday, May 24, 2025, President Kengo Suzuki (Dr.Kengo) delivered a guest lecture as a part-time instructor for the “Entrepreneurship” course at the Graduate School of Industrial Technology (Professional Graduate School), Tokyo University of Agriculture and Technology.
The course, aimed at both working professionals and students directly entering from undergraduate programs, served as a platform to bridge academia and industry by offering real-world insights into startups and business innovation. Drawing from his academic background—holding doctoral degrees in both agriculture and medicine—as well as his leadership in revitalizing Tsunan Brewery, Dr.Kengo presented on the theme of “Reviving and Advancing Existing Businesses through Scientific Knowledge.”
Lecture Overview
Dr.Kengo began by introducing the challenges faced by Tsunan Brewery, located in Tsunan Town, one of Japan’s heaviest snowfall areas, and explained how scientific approaches were applied to create new value. Examples included leveraging the snow-covered environment for low-temperature aging, microbial control, and stable fermentation in a snow-covered cellar—highlighting the fusion of nature and technology.
He then discussed the brewery’s efforts to integrate AI technologies with fermentation science, a concept known as “smart brewing.” The use of AI models to analyze sake aroma and flavor quantitatively, along with initiatives to restructure management resources and manufacturing processes using generative AI, captured the keen interest of students.
The lecture also introduced Tsunan Brewery’s ongoing research on the intersection of sake and healthcare. Focused on functional ingredients such as ergothioneine and agmatine found in sake, the company is exploring their potential in aging suppression and wellness promotion. This has led to the development of supplements and innovative products. Dr.Kengo also touched on futuristic challenges such as the “Lunar Sake Brewery” project, applying fermentation technologies to space exploration—offering a multifaceted perspective on the topic.
Discussing business development, Dr.Kengo emphasized the importance of local partnerships with rice farmers, brand renewal, and overseas expansion. He showcased products like the “GO GRANDCLASS,” made with 100% Uonuma Koshihikari rice, and the sparkling sake series known for its balance of sweetness and acidity—both recognized as high-value products in domestic and international markets.

About Tsunan Sake Brewery
Tsunan Sake Brewery Co., Ltd. is a sake brewery based in Tsunan Town, Niigata Prefecture—one of Japan’s most prominent snow regions. The brewery uses pristine natural water sourced from 2,000-meter-high mountains and locally grown sake rice varieties such as “Gohyakumangoku” and “Uonuma Koshihikari.” Tsunan Brewery’s philosophy centers around the fusion of nature and innovation, embodied in its brand concept: “Brew for Future – Brewing a Coexistent Future.” In 2025, the brewery was awarded the prestigious Niigata Governor’s Prize (1st Place) at the Echigo-style Brewing Technology Championship.
